Overview

3Z-20-005 is a preclinical-stage small molecule drug candidate being developed by 3Z Studio (also known as 3Z Pharmaceuticals) for the treatment of neurological indications. It functions as an imidazoline I1 receptor agonist. The compound was identified through a drug repurposing strategy utilizing a unique zebrafish-based behavioral screening platform designed to discover therapeutic candidates for central nervous system (CNS) disorders. While the specific target indication within the neurological space has not been publicly disclosed, the company's research focus includes conditions such as att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and insomnia. 3Z-20-005 has demonstrated proof-of-concept (POC) in zebrafish models.
